About Hanyang Li
Hanyang Li is a scholar working on Electrical and Electronic Engineering,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ics and Biomedical Engineering, having authored 151 papers that have together received 2.2k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Photonic and Optical Devices (52 papers), Advanced Fiber Optic Sensors (34 papers), Advanced Fiber Laser Technologies (17 papers), Luminescence Properties of Advanced Materials (14 papers), Mechanical and Optical Resonators (13 papers), Photonic Crystals and Applications (13 papers), Plasmonic and Surface Plasmon Research (10 papers) and Advancements in Battery Materials (7 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Electrical and Electronic Engineering (1.1k citations),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ics (494 citations) and Bioengineering (89 citations). Hanyang Li has collaborated with scholars based in China, United States and Australia. Frequent co-authors include Jun Yang, Yanzeng Li, Shuangqiang Liu, Yan Wang, Yu Wang, Yong‐Chang Jiao, Lu Liu, Yongjun Liu, Liyuan Zhao and Yundong Zhang. Their work appears in journals such as Nucleic Acids Research, Advanced Materials and Journal of Biological Chemistry.
